I found this recipe in a family cookbook put together for a bridal shower. I love the fact that I can put the omelet to bake in the oven while I make other ingredients, such as #8602 Sausage Gravy and Biscuits, on the stove. With the addition of fresh fruit, the combination was a huge hit with visiting company.

Steps:
- Fry bacon and drain; chop into pieces. (I make mine in the microwave).
- Arrange cheese slices in the bottom of a lightly-buttered 9 inch pie pan. (I use glass.).
- Beat together eggs and milk with a fork. Add chopped bacon and pour over cheese.
- Bake at 350° for 45 to 50 minutes, until eggs are set in the middle.
- Let stand 5 minutes before cutting.
- Note: you can reheat left-over portions in the microwave upside down, with cheese on the top.
- You might want to add some herbs on the top, too!
